Product Description Item #: 41021B. For studio-quality, high-definition TV, the 47-inch Olevia 747i delivers a simply stunning HDTV experience for home or commercial applications. Engineered to display the richest, most vibrant images, the Olevia 747i LCD HDTV features the industry's most advanced SiliconOptix Realta Hollywood Quality Video (HQV) processor powered by Teranex technology. It offers dual combo ATSC/NTSC tuners, a super-wide 178-degree viewing angle, 1600: 1 Dynamic Contrast Ratio, and fast response time. With dual HDMI connectivity and three component inputs, the Olevia 747i delivers it all - high-definition digital TV and widescreen movies, standard analog TV, action sports, video games, and home videos - with stunningly crisp, vibrant imagery and realistic, immersive sound. This 47-inch HDTV can even double as a presentation display with support for PC resolutions up to 1920x1080 through HDMI and VGA. The 747i's interchangeable mounted speakers complement its D2Audio DAE-1 (Digital Audio Engine) intelligent digital amplifier and SoundSuite audio enhancement software. The result? Theater-quality audio and an exceptional entertainment experience - all thanks to Olevia.The 747i is one of the Olevia 7 Series LCD HDTVs designed expressly to deliver breakthrough performance and top quality. Vibrant images, powerful dual combo tuner technology for viewing two HD stations simultaneously, and built-in RS-232 control for connection with entertainment systems and media centers make the Olevia 7 Series ideal for virtually any content and any environment. Kaput! Both this TV, its manufacturer and any support for it! April 1, 2010 kxxxk (Tullahoma TN USA) I have owned this model of Olevia TV for 2 years and 3 months. I liked it a lot. Tonight no imagery of any kind, whether originating externally or internally, would appear after the Olevia start-up screen. When I went to contact support, I found the olevia.com website no longer exists! I also learned that the manufacturer, Syntax-Brillian Corporation, has gone belly-up (http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Syntax-Brillian_Corporation) and that its assets, including the Olevia brand name, were sold, in May 2009, to the Emerson Radio Corp. whose website does not list any Olevia products or Olevia product support whatsoever. Googling "Olevia TV", "Syntax-Brillian", and "Syntax Olevia" brought up either old materials or content that reinforced the previously stated facts. So the TVs being sold here appear to be the remains from the last manufacturing runs of a long defunct company.
